When it comes to buying a car today, one thing matters more than ever:
👉 Safety.
And now, Suzuki’s upcoming electric SUV — the Suzuki eVitara — has taken a big step by scoring a 4-star safety rating at ANCAP.
For a brand entering the EV space seriously, this is an important moment.
But what does this rating actually mean for buyers? Let’s break it down.

📊 Safety Rating Overview
- Safety Agency: ANCAP (Australia & New Zealand)
- Overall Rating: ⭐⭐⭐⭐ (4-Star)
- Segment: Electric SUV
👉 A 4-star rating puts the eVitara in a strong and competitive position.

🚗 What is the eVitara?
The eVitara is Suzuki’s first major global electric SUV, built for multiple markets.
Expected highlights:
- Modern EV platform
- SUV stance with practical design
- Focus on efficiency and usability
👉 It’s not just another EV — it’s a big shift for the brand.
